As smartphones take over the world, dermatology apps multiply As technology continues to advance, so too does its accessibility to the general population. In 2013, only 56 percent of Americans owned a smartphone, which climbed to 77 percent in 2017. Next year, there were around 1.56 billion smartphones sales worldwide, and the user number reached more than 2.71 billion by now. With planet Earth’s population over 7.6 billion, these numbers show that approximately 20 percent of all people got a new smartphone last year. As a consequence, smartphone apps of all categories multiplied exponentially. In dermatology, a study published in 2017 found 526 apps corresponding to an 80.8 percent growth in smartphone-based platforms since 2014.
